To improve the heat retention by diapers and other absorbents, a heat retention indicator 1 of a water-absorbing resin which is defined in the present invention needs be 3.0° C./min or less and also that particular requirements need be met to satisfy this condition. If the requirements are met, a water-absorbing resin, absorbent, and absorbent article can be provided which has a heat retention indicator 1 of 0 to 3.0° C./min or less and which exhibits excellent heat retention and absorption.

A water-absorbing agent, comprising 90 wt. % or more of a water-absorbing resin including a partially neutralized polymer of polyacrylic acid, the partially neutralized polymer having a crosslinking structure constructed by polymerization of an acrylic acid (salt) (a monomer other than the acrylic acid (salt) is 0 to 30 mole % relative to the acrylic acid (salt)), wherein the water-absorbing agent is surface-treated, andthe water-absorbing resin contains 10 to 40 mole % of acrylic acid and 90 to 60 mole % of acrylate (the sum should be 100 mole %), and salt-forming neutralization of the water-absorbing resin is (i) performed before polymerization while the water-absorbing resin is in monomer form, or (ii) performed during or after polymerization while the water-absorbing resin is in polymer form, or (iii) performed by a combination of (i) and (ii),the water-absorbing agent contains (iv) polyhydric alcohol containing 2 to 10 carbons per molecule or (v) water-insoluble inorganic fine particles,the water-absorbing agent meets all of properties (1) through (4):(1) heat retention indicator 1 (maximum temperature decrease per minute 5 to 10 minutes after 10 times swelling in a 0.90 wt. % sodium chloride at 50° C.) is from 0 to 3.0° C./min;(2) a centrifuge retention capacity in a 0.90 wt. % aqueous solution of sodium chloride (30 minute value) is 34 g/g or less;(3) an absorbency in a 0.90 wt. % aqueous solution of sodium chloride against a pressure of 2.0 kPa (60 minute value) is less than 30 g/g; and(4) a saline flow conductivity (SFC) for a 0.69 wt. % aqueous solution of sodium chloride is less than 20×10−7 cm3 sec/g, whereinthe water-absorbing agent is particles,the water-absorbing agent meets following conditions:particles having diameters from 600 to 300 μm as specified by sieve classification account for 60 wt. % or more, and those less than 150 μm account for 3 wt. % or less; anda standard deviation of logarithm (G) of particle size distribution is from 0.250 to 0.400;wherein a mass-average particle diameter (specified by sieve classification) is from 400 to 600 μm. 2.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1, further comprising water-insoluble inorganic fine particles, besides the water-absorbing resin. 3.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 2 wherein the water-absorbing agent contains water-insoluble inorganic fine particles of 0.0001 to 10 wt. %. 4.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1, wherein a heat retention indicator 2 (gel surface temperature 10 minutes after 10 times swelling in a 0.90 wt. % sodium chloride at 50° C.) is 20° C. or higher. 5.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1, wherein a heat retention indicator 3 (time taken by a gel surface temperature to return to 37° C. after 10 times swelling in a 0.90 wt. % sodium chloride at 50° C.) is 120 seconds or longer. 6.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1, wherein a content of the polyhydric alcohol is 0.001 to 10 wt. % relative to the water-absorbing resin. 7.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1, wherein: the polyhydric alcohol is selected from polyhydric alcohol compounds such as mono, di, tri, and tetra ethylene glycol, monopropylene glycol, 1,3-propanediol, dipropylene glycol, 2,3,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entanediol, glycerine, polyglycerine, 2-butene-1,4-diol, 1,4-butanediol, 1,3-butanediol, 1,5-pentanediol, 1,6-hexanediol, and 1,2-cyclohexanedimethanol. 8.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1, wherein: a content of the water-insoluble inorganic fine particles is 0.0001 to 5 wt. % relative to the water-absorbing resin. 9. The water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1, wherein: the surface crosslinking agent is selected from polyhydric alcohol compounds, epoxy compounds, polyamine compounds and their condensates with haloepoxy compounds, oxazoline compounds, mono, di, and polyoxazolidinone compounds, polyvalent metallic compounds, and alkylene carbonate compounds. 10. An absorbent, comprising the water-absorbing agent as set forth in claim 1 and hydrophilic fibers. 11. The absorbent as set forth in claim 10, wherein the water-absorbing agent accounts for 20 wt. % or more of a total of the water-absorbing agent and hydrophilic fibers. 12. An absorbent article, comprising the absorbent as set forth in claim 10; a liquid-permeable top sheet; and a liquid-impermeable back sheet.
